Description
  • Lead onsite construction activities for large ground‑up multifamily and podium projects ranging from $30M-$60M.
  • Drive the schedule using detailed look‑ahead planning, trade coordination, and proactive issue resolution.
  • Champion safety with daily audits, toolbox talks, and consistent enforcement of company and OSHA standards.
  • Oversee site logistics including sitework, utilities, crane picks, deliveries, laydown, and jobsite flow.
  • Run daily and weekly meetings with subcontractors, ensuring alignment on sequencing, quality, and milestones.
  • Lead quality control through pre‑installation meetings, inspections, punch management, and attention to detail.
  • Coordinate MEP/FP systems with trade partners and support commissioning, start‑ups, and life‑safety testing.
  • Maintain strong relationships with owners, design partners, inspectors, and field teams.
  • Document progress with daily reports, photos, and clear communication with the project team.
  • Drive project closeout including punchlist burn‑down, turnover planning, and warranty support.
Profile
  • Strong proven experience as a Superintendent overseeing large, ground‑up multifamily, podium, mid‑rise, or similarly complex vertical commercial construction.
  • Strong ability to coordinate MEP/FP, structure, envelope, and interior progress on large‑scale projects.
  • Skilled communicator with a calm, steady leadership style that builds trust with field crews and trade partners.
  • Highly organized and proactive, able to anticipate issues early and maintain schedule integrity.
  • Proficient with industry tools such as Procore, Bluebeam, or comparable platforms.
  • OSHA‑30 required; additional safety or quality certifications a plus.
